But what is impact investing?

“The deployment of capital with an expectation of financial return, where the success of the investment is also contingent

upon achieving a state social or environmental goal.”

–Amy Bell, the Executive Director and Head of Principal Investments for J.P Morgan’s Social Finance business unit

Impact InvestingThese investments can be made in both emerging as well as developed markets, and focuses on a variety of returns from below to market rate. The impact investment market is able to bestow capital upon some of the biggest issues impacting the world today, including housing, healthcare, and education as well as sustainable agriculture, clean technology and more.

There are four core characteristics when it comes to impact investing:

IntentionalityEssential to getting involved in impact investing, investors should want to make a positive social or environmental impact just as much, if not more, than they want to make a profit.

ExpectationsWhile philanthropic, these investments are still expected to generate a financial return on capital for the investors. At the very least, investors should expect a return of capital.

Range of return expectations & asset classes

Targeting financial returns that range anywhere from below market to risk-adjusted market rate. These returns can be made across asset classes including cash equivalents and private equity.

Impact measurementWhen entering the impact investment market, investors make a commitment to measure and report the social and/or environmental performance and progress of any underlying investments. They should uphold transparency and accountability at all times.
